In this episode of the Mediate Your Life podcast, John sits down with Richard Schwartz, founder of the internationally renowned and respected work of Internal Family Systems (IFS), for a wide-ranging and heart-warming dialogue on the bridges between IFS, Nonviolent Communication (NVC), and Mediate Your Life models and approaches, as well as revealing and inspiring conversation about Dick's life, core aspects of the models, and the healing of our world. Dick shares the unlikely origins of IFS, including the personal struggles that nearly stopped him from bringing it forward, and why humility even more than brilliance turned out to be key to its success. Together, Dick and John explore how Self in IFS and empathic presence and needs language in NVC are pointing at the same essential ground, how parts language can support NVC practice, and why speaking from Self rather than parts changes everything in conflict and communication. The conversation moves from the deeply personal to the boldly collective — touching on spirituality, legacy trauma, the social-political world, and what it might mean to bring more Self-energy onto the planet at this moment in history.
